Output 527c39b69c9c86c7a32634e470ac0642bba27f2d04bca7664d5310b68460be36:1

value
1386674
script pubkey
OP_HASH160 OP_PUSHBYTES_20 571cf5b5caa92c17e672dd0452ef81454ce0466c OP_EQUAL
address
39ddQPtr66uBBWzEfDTNZ3iLoPcrer2BgV
transaction
527c39b69c9c86c7a32634e470ac0642bba27f2d04bca7664d5310b68460be36
spent
true